ABOUT JAVONNI D. AYERS

One word sums up the secret to Javonni Ayers’ leadership success; SERVICE. As a child, the recent graduate of South Carolina State University Political Science major learned the importance of serving her community. Lessons from her parents and examples set by her older siblings taught her that the best way to empower herself was through taking advantage of educational opportunities and volunteering to help those less fortunate. On that premise, she has continuously served her university, and its surrounding communities by taking part in a surfeit of public service activities, programs, and events. One of her most memorable community service activities was volunteering at the WM. Jennings Dorn Veteran Affairs Hospital in Columbia where she served as a caregiver to sick and disabled veterans.As the first two-term female Student Government Association President at SC State, Ayers is a Dr. Emily England Clyburn Scholar of the University’s Honors College. Some of her many accomplishments also include the White House Initiative on HBCU’s scholar, NAACP Legal Defense Fund HBCU ambassador and Goldman Sachs HBCU scholar, and a proud member of Delta Sigma Theta Sorority, Incorporated. Her accomplishments as a student-leader and scholar have allowed her to play integral leadership roles in a myriad of university and community organizations that support the causes she is most passionate about. These include her desire to become an attorney and champion for marginalized populations through community development projects and initiatives.Ms. Ayers has garnered numerous national and statewide awards and recognitions and was most notably featured during the 2018 Summer TedTalk Conference in Washington D.C. She also had the opportunity to work as an intern for US House Majority Whip, the Honorable James E. Clyburn. She recently had the opportunity of creating a State Bill that acknowledges the Historically Black Colleges and Universities in the state of South Carolina.
